Franchot Park is a park that speaks volumes about Olean...it has a little bit of everything: a wading pool, basketball courts, picnic pavilions, playground, horseshoes and ball field...but more importantly its got a feel that sticks with one their whole life. Its a place where kids from all walks of life get to celebrate a warm summer day in the cool spray of the pool or fly a kite in the spring breeze.
I learned to swim in the pool when I was in 3rd grade and I still remember the wonderful sensation of floating. I regularly took my very young children there to cool off on a hot day when nothing else seemed to make them happy.
